Check with Asus as they made the motherboard and see what they say on line and also with their tech support people. I had this happen years ago and the issue was dust in the connector to the motherboard. Since we have two English bulldogs, two Pugs and a Main Coon, I now clean the computer every few months very well.
You could also try replacing the cables as they do deteriorate over time. Otherwise get a new drive.
